Let's talk about why everyone was confused for a bit. This movie was originally supposed to be a TV show. Yeah, a Disney+ series. Disney saw the internal footage, realized it was actually a banger, and pivoted to a full theatrical release. Because of that, the path to watching it online was a bit different than, say, Frozen 2.

It crushed the box office—crossing the billion-dollar mark faster than almost any other animated sequel. That success meant Disney kept it in theaters longer. They weren't in a rush to put it online for "free" with a subscription when people were still paying 15 bucks a seat.

What’s the Story This Time?

If you haven't seen it yet, here is the quick, no-spoiler breakdown. It's set three years after the first film. Moana is older, she’s a leader, and she’s got a little sister named Simea who is honestly adorable.

She gets a "call" from her ancestors (standard Moana stuff, right?) and has to find the lost island of Motufetu. The goal is to reconnect all the people of the ocean who have been hidden away by a storm god named Nalo.

A Few New Faces

The crew isn't just Moana and Maui this time.

  • Loto: A quirky builder/architect.
  • Moni: A historian who is basically a Maui fanboy.
  • Kele: A grumpy farmer who somehow ends up on a boat.

It’s a different vibe. Not just a girl and a demigod, but a full-on team. Maui doesn't even show up immediately—he’s actually in a bit of trouble when the movie starts.

The Critical Split: Is it Actually Good?

Here is where things get interesting. Critics were... okay with it. It holds around a 60% on Rotten Tomatoes from professionals. But the fans? They loved it. The audience score is way higher.

The main complaint you'll hear is about the music. Lin-Manuel Miranda didn't return for this one. Instead, we got Abigail Barlow and Emily Bear (the duo behind the Bridgerton Musical). The songs like "Beyond" are good, but they don't quite have that "You're Welcome" earworm energy that the first movie had.
